§ 6A-9-340 - Effectiveness of right of recoupment or set-off against deposit account.

SECTION 6A-9-340

   § 6A-9-340  Effectiveness of right ofrecoupment or set-off against deposit account. – (a) Exercise of recoupment or set-off. Except as otherwise provided insubsection (c), a bank with which a deposit account is maintained may exerciseany right of recoupment or set-off against a secured party that holds asecurity interest in the deposit account.

   (b) Recoupment or set-off not affected by securityinterest. Except as otherwise provided in subsection (c), the applicationof this chapter to a security interest in a deposit account does not affect aright of recoupment or set-off of the secured party as to a deposit accountmaintained with the secured party.

   (c) When set-off ineffective. The exercise by a bankof a set-off against a deposit account is ineffective against a secured partythat holds a security interest in the deposit account which is perfected bycontrol under § 6A-9-104(a)(3), if the set-off is based on a claim againstthe debtor.
